Transfer to/from - Ho Chi Minh airport (SGN)

 

Public transportation services, licensed taxis and rideshare, private transfer companies and car rental services in Ho Chi Minh airport (SGN)

Transportation

 

Ride-sharing

Once you arrive at the airport and have collected your luggage, you can request a ride using the Grab app. Choosing the airport as your starting point, wait for your transfer to be confirmed and then simply follow the instructions in the app on your mobile phone to meet your driver.

Bus

Services depart from column 18 of Terminal 1 and column 15 of Terminal 2, with a journey time to the city centre of 60-90 minutes.

- Line 49: Hoang Van Thu, Nguyen Van Troi, Nam Ky Khoi Nghia, Le Duan, Dong Khoi, Hai Ba Trung, Ham Nghi, Ben Thanh Market (5:45 am to 1:00 am)
- Line 109: Hoang Van Thu, Nguyen Van Troi, Nam Ky Khoi Nghia, Ham Nghi, Ben Thanh Market, Pham Ngu Lao, September 23 Park (5:45 am to 1:00 am)
- Line 152: Hoang Van Thu, Nguyen Van Troi, Nam Ky Khoi Nghia, Cach Mang Thang Tam, Ben Thanh Market, Tran Hung Dao, Trung Son Residential Area (5:45 am to 6:15 pm)

Taxi

The ranks are located outside the Arrivals level of the terminals. The journey to the city centre is 20-30 minutes, depending on traffic. There are booking counters in the Arrivals areas. The companies operating within the premises are Vinasun Taxi (Tel +84 28 3827 2727) and Mai Linh Taxi (Tel +84 28 38 29 8888).

Transportation Tips to/from the airport

Although there are issues that seem more than obvious, it is always advisable to take them into account when moving to or from the airport, and especially if we go by public transport.
 
 1- To the airport - It is convenient to leave with a little more anticipation than what is commonly suggested. If you choose a taxi or a private car service, always take into account peak traffic times, demonstrations, strikes or events that may delay the journey to the airport from where you are. It is always good to be informed about what is happening.
 
If you contract a shared transfer service, have a contact telephone number handy in case of any delay by the company. In these cases they usually already have a scheduled collection time.
 
If you use public transport (collective, train) take into account the schedules (weekends and holidays tend to have less frequency), if you have to change and also how to board (if you need a card or paying the driver or motorist at the moment ). These are details that seem obvious, but it is advisable to know so as not to have surprises and suffer a delay that could cause complications.
 
If you rent a car to get to the airport, check where to leave the vehicle. At some airports, there is an exclusive parking lot for rental cars.
 
 2 -From the airport- Here it is a little less stressful since you don't have the pressure of missing your flight. In the worst case, you will arrive later at the place where you are going to stay or at the meeting point where you are trying to arrive.
 
Once you leave the plane, look for your suitcase and finish with the arrival procedures that are required. Then, follow the directions for public transportation or ask the airport staff.
 
It is very useful to find out in advance the schedules of the buses or trains in case you arrive late at night. Not all work 24 hours. The same goes for taxis. In case of using an Uber-type service, have the mobile application handy to contact the driver.
 
On the other hand, if you booked a private transport service, it is likely that they will have a person waiting for you, identified with a sign. If you rent a car to go from the airport to your final destination, for greater peace of mind it is advisable to book it in advance. Rental counters are usually available in the arrivals hall.
